2007 BRFSS Survey Results: Randolph County

Diabetes

Are you now taking insulin?

  Total
Respond.^
Yes No
N % C.I.(95%) N % C.I.(95%)
North Carolina 1,825 529 29.3 26.5-32.3 1,296 70.7 67.7-73.5
-Randolph County 49 12 31.5 16.6-51.5 37 68.5 48.5-83.4
GENDER
Male 23 5 21.9 9.0-44.1 18 78.1 55.9-91.0
Female 26 7 40.6 17.5-68.8 19 59.4 31.2-82.5
RACE
White 45 12 34.8 18.7-55.4 33 65.2 44.6-81.3
Other 3 0 0.0 . - . 3 100 . - .
AGE
18-44 5 2 64.5 20.6-92.7 3 35.5 7.3-79.4
45+ 44 10 23.4 12.4-39.8 34 76.6 60.2-87.6
EDUCATION
H.S. or Less 34 9 28.5 14.7-47.8 25 71.5 52.2-85.3
Some College + 15 3 36.6 10.3-74.3 12 63.4 25.7-89.7
HOUSEHOLD INCOME
Less than $50,000 33 11 34.9 19.6-54.1 22 65.1 45.9-80.4
$50,000+ 9 1 33.7 5.8-80.6 8 66.3 19.4-94.2

^Use caution in interpreting percentages with a numerator of less than 20. N = numerator, % = Percentage, C.I.(95%) = Confidence Interval (at 95 percent probability level).
Percentages are weighted to population characteristics and therefore cannot be calculated exactly from the numbers in this table.
